As Secretary General of the Italian Union for Sustainable Palm Oil, Francesca Ronca leverages her food sector expertise to promote certified, deforestation-free supply chains through science-based dialogue, institutional communication, and multi-stakeholder collaboration.
Presentation:
Climate-friendly food chains in practice: traceability, certification and responsible palm oil sourcing
Key Points:
• Addresses palm oil’s impact on deforestation and biodiversity while framing it as a model for creating transparent, climate-friendly global supply chains.
• Outlines the Italian Union for Sustainable Palm Oil’s approach to responsible sourcing, focusing on certification, traceability, supplier engagement, and governance.
• Highlights the role of voluntary standards like RSPO and third-party verification in driving responsible production and continuous improvement.
• Discusses the relevance of these tools within the framework of the EU Deforestation Regulation (EUDR) and broader corporate ESG strategies.
